Coordinating Product Roadshows Across Multiple Cities

Organizing product roadshows effectively involves intricate planning and execution. Teams must ensure they address both logistical challenges and marketing strategies. A successful roadshow presents an opportunity to showcase products, engage with audiences, and collect valuable feedback. Coordinators should start by identifying cities that align with the target demographic and product relevance. Once cities are chosen, venue selection becomes critical; consider local popularity, accessibility, and amenities. Additionally, establishing dates that avoid conflicts with local events can foster better attendance. Next, develop a cohesive marketing plan that leverages various channels. Utilize email campaigns, social media, and partnerships with local influencers to generate buzz. Create engaging promotional content that emphasizes the value proposition of the product, enticing attendees. Planning should also encompass transportation logistics for the product display and team members. Coordinate with local vendors for setup, refreshments, and other necessities. Consider technology needs for presentations, workshops, and interactive experiences. Lastly, it’s vital to gather data during the roadshow for insights on product reception and customer expectations. This feedback will guide future product developments and marketing efforts.

Key Elements for Successful Execution

To ensure that the product roadshow resonates with attendees, effective communication is essential. Each city may have a unique culture, and understanding these dynamics enhances presentations and engagement techniques. Before the roadshow, research local customs, preferences, and relevant market trends. Tailoring the promotion to match regional interests increases the likelihood of attendance. Additionally, developing a captivating presentation is paramount. Emphasizing storytelling within product demonstrations captivates audiences and establishes emotional connections. Incorporate visuals, testimonials, and case studies to enrich the narrative and bolster credibility. Utilize interactive elements such as Q&A sessions or product trials to encourage audience participation. Hands-on engagement aids retention and bolsters credibility around the product experience. Ensure a seamless flow during the presentations; practice with the team to refine delivery and address potential technical challenges. Maintain a checklist of necessary equipment to avoid snags on the day of the event. Plan for contingencies, such as backup technology solutions, to address unexpected issues. Above all, embody enthusiasm for the product; genuine excitement is contagious and inspires the audience to share in that energy. Such elements are essential to a successful product roadshow that leaves a lasting impression.

Utilizing Technology for Enhanced Engagement

Embracing technology in your product roadshow enhances audience engagement substantially. By integrating cutting-edge tools into the experience, you cultivate interactive, memorable sessions. Mobile applications can facilitate audience participation by providing real-time polls, quizzes, and feedback mechanisms. Attendees can access exclusive content through these platforms, forging personal connections with your brand. Consider using augmented reality (AR) or virtual reality (VR) experiences to simulate product applications. These technologies elevate understanding, particularly for complex products, by allowing attendees to envision real-world uses. Panels or virtual consultations with industry experts can further enrich the experience, providing distinct value beyond the typical product demonstration. Moreover, employing social media during the event fosters a sense of community, allowing attendees to share experiences and thoughts in real-time. Design a unique event hashtag to encourage posting and create engagement across platforms. Live streaming portions of the roadshow broadens reach, enabling those unable to attend to participate virtually. Importantly, ensure reliable internet connectivity at each venue to support technological needs without interruptions. Leveraging technology guarantees that your roadshow is cutting-edge, engaging, and ultimately, successful.
